A center drill set, also known as a combined drill and countersink, is a specialized tool used in machining and metalworking to create a conical hole for a lathe center or a starting point for a twist drill. They combine the functions of drilling a pilot hole and countersinking, all in one operation.

Choose a set that includes a variety of sizes to accommodate different hole diameters. A typical set might range from #0 to #8.
The countersink angle should match the angle of the lathe center or the screw head you are using. Common angles are 60 degrees and 90 degrees.

This table compares different center drill sets based on key features.
Feature | HSS Center Drill | Cobalt Center Drill | Carbide Center Drill |
---|---|---|---|
Material | High-Speed Steel | Cobalt Steel | Carbide |
Hardness | Moderate | High | Very High |
Heat Resistance | Moderate | High | Very High |
Cost | Low | Moderate | High |
Typical Use | General-purpose drilling | Harder materials, stainless steel | Demanding machining applications |
